New York writer Harry Quabert is looking for a place to help him write and then he sets up a home in Guzkov, Aurora, New Hampshire. The trees behind the house, sitting in the dense forest of terraces, show gulls flying over the sea, and the waves are sweeping in front of them. Harry met a girl who was dancing alone at the beach one day and soon became close. Every society has its morals and its norms, and it has its laws. Socially, romance with minors cannot be expected to look in favor. Harry Quabert, who is 15 years old and happy with the surprise he met at the beach in front of his home, is still struggling to escape social responsibility and obligation. Love that cannot be approached or withdrawn, love that is not blessed by people in the neighborhood, and love that cannot come to pass produces a ruptured feeling. You can't always hide and love someone you don't see. Harry and his surprise promised to flee to Canada for wanting to love each other without any interference, but then the day he decided to sneak away, a surprise occurred when he disappeared.
